Cómo bloquear un rango de IPs en htaccess?

  • Autor Autor israel1094
  • Fecha de inicio Fecha de inicio
israel1094

israel1094

Dseda
Verificado
Verificación en dos pasos activada
Verificado por Whatsapp
Verificado por Binance
Hola, haber si alguien pudiera ayudarme.


El rango que quisiera seria:

164.132.x.x

Todos los de 'x'
 
Si no estoy equivocado, basta que cierres la I.P con el comando DENY.

Ejemplo:



Configurar restricciones

order allow, deny

deny from 255.0.0.0

deny from 164.13.x.x [Ip inventada]

El código sugiere bloquear las IPS fuera de rango. Si en el número final pones un 1 eso hará que el servidor apache bloquee todas las IPs, que vayan desde 123.45.6.1 hasta 123.45.6.255.

Si prefieres dejar la tuya activa (IP) y bloquear el resto:

order allow, deny

allow from 123.45.6.7*

deny from all

Espero sea sencillo de entender. Viene a ser lo mismo que bloquearlo en un router para que no te roben el wifi. 🙂
 
Gracias por tu respuesta.

El mismo cpanel dice que se puede hacer asi: 164.132.*.*
pero marca que es un rango no valido

qLdK3ti4S3ikgb-J3fBdNA.webp

Si no estoy equivocado, basta que cierres la I.P con el comando DENY.

Ejemplo:



Configurar restricciones

order allow, deny

deny from 255.0.0.0

deny from 164.13.x.x [Ip inventada]

El código sugiere bloquear las IPS fuera de rango. Si en el número final pones un 1 eso hará que el servidor apache bloquee todas las IPs, que vayan desde 123.45.6.1 hasta 123.45.6.255.

Si prefieres dejar la tuya activa (IP) y bloquear el resto:

order allow, deny

allow from 123.45.6.7*

deny from all

Espero sea sencillo de entender. Viene a ser lo mismo que bloquearlo en un router para que no te roben el wifi. 🙂
 
Las direcciones IP no pueden contener asteriscos, se abren y cierran numéricamente. Es decir, que si le indicas un rango de IP: 164.132.x.x realmente no es un rango válido por que el asterisco no cierra rango. Disculpa si aparece así predeterminado.

Prueba: 164.132.1.150 -> de esta manera bloquearía todas las IPs del rango 1-150.

Mientras llegan refuerzos, coméntame si te ha servido.
 
Insertar CODE, HTML o PHP:
Order Allow,Deny
Deny from 164.132.0.0/16
Allow from all

Insertar CODE, HTML o PHP:
<Files *>
  <RequireAll>
    Require all granted

# Block IP
Require not ip 164.132.0.0/16

  </RequireAll>

</Files>

Podes usar cualquiera.
 
Amigo desconozco si la idea es evitar instalar plugins, pero sino puedes hacerlo instalando WordFence Security. Saludos 😉
 
Atrás
Arriba